在填充表单

时间:2015-12-10 06:56:47

标签: php jquery mysql wordpress forms

当我在WordPress CMS中使用PHP编程语言和Mysql DB编写程序时,我构建了一个插件,用于在特殊工作流程中创建和处理自定义表单,以满足客户的需求。

在用户填写表单后,该站点的一个编辑用户将检查填充表单的数据并验证它们。 向编辑用户显示的验证页面的屏幕截图如下所示。

enter image description here

如您所见,我从数据库中获取表单数据并将其打印到编辑用户以验证它们。首先,所有字段都以绿色背景显示。通过使用jQuery,我让编辑器用户能够点击有问题的填充并将字段的颜色更改为红色。如下面的屏幕截图。

enter image description here

我的问题是,如何存储有关哪些字段填充了错误数据的数据(以红色背景显示的字段),并使用此类元数据为最终用户创建编辑页面以更正该字段?

诅咒有很多方法可以做到这一点。最简单但在我的想法中不优化方法是将布尔字段匹配添加到数据库中的表单字段,并根据布尔字段提交隐藏字段以存储每个字段正确(TRUE)或不正确(FALSE)的信息。

我正在处理的表单大约有174个字段,其中大多数是varchar(254)。因此,存储在数据库中的数据量很大,我不想让它变大。

最后,请你帮助我。是否有任何其他方法来存储编辑器用户的jQuery操作,并将存储的数据显示给最终用户。

我正在寻求你的帮助。 最好成绩。

0 个答案:

没有答案